After we left on Saturday from Ben Delatour we meet Mark Versh and other scouts at Eldorado Canyon to go to the 14er. When we got to the Trailhead of Grays Peak to camp, we were at 11,000 feet elevation. That night we had spaghetti for dinner.

 

We woke-up very early the next morning at around 5 a.m. We started the hike at 6:15 a.m. It toke us around 4-5 hours to go up. While we were on top of the mountain we had lunch. It was 14,270 feet elevation on the top. The view was amazing! It took us about 3-4 hours to go back down. After we got down we took down the tents and went to another church in Denver, Colorado.
